Abstract
I present a measurement of the tt differential cross section, do-/dM, in pp collisions at Vi 1.96
TeV using 2.7 fb-1 of CDF II data. I find that do/dMg is consistent with the Standard Model
expectation, as modeled by PYTHIA with CTEQ5L parton distribution functions. I set limits on the
ratio n/Mp, in the Randall-Sundrum model by looking for Kaluza Klein gravitons which decay to
top quarks. I find n/Mp, > 0.16 at the 95% confidence level.ii
